Transaction 341381377be258378ee70780f82744e47469495d05a0b5cc8cb3ba6e115b2e17
1 Input
1 Output
-
341381377be258378ee70780f82744e47469495d05a0b5cc8cb3ba6e115b2e17:0
- value
- 2272061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 524f51e9499b6b02f125ae165fb3ce2ccd5e6cca OP_EQUAL
- address
- 39CEMXDFbk6Z95e4BcsUukmvGEYrr3dbsb